encode bank account name and show BIC

This commit is contained in:
Sebastian 2022-11-04 15:58:43 -03:00
parent 709ac2349c
commit 661469f878
No known key found for this signature in database
GPG Key ID: BE4FF68352439FC1
2 changed files with 7 additions and 2 deletions

View File

@ -122,7 +122,12 @@ export function BankDetailsByPaytoType({
/>
</Fragment>
) : payto.targetType === "iban" ? (
<Row name={<i18n.Translate>IBAN</i18n.Translate>} value={payto.iban} />
<Fragment>
{payto.bic !== undefined ?
<Row name={<i18n.Translate>BIC</i18n.Translate>} value={payto.bic} />
: undefined}
<Row name={<i18n.Translate>IBAN</i18n.Translate>} value={payto.iban} />
</Fragment>
) : undefined;
const receiver = payto.params["receiver"] || undefined;

View File

@ -521,7 +521,7 @@ function IbanAddressAccount({ field }: { field: TextFieldHandler }): VNode {
onChange={(v) => {
setName(v);
if (!errors) {
field.onInput(`payto://iban/${number}?receiver-name=${v}`);
field.onInput(`payto://iban/${number}?receiver-name=${encodeURIComponent(v)}`);
}
}}
/>